has recently partnered with to launch a Fund, allowing acceptance of Bitcoin, stablecoins, and other digital assets to speed up aid. This innovation raises key compliance questions for Indian NGOs under the Foreign Contribution Regulation Act ( ), 2010.

Section 17 of the FCRA Act mandates routing all foreign contributions exclusively through a designated State Bank of India account at its New Delhi Main Branch. Cryptocurrencies, treated as Virtual Digital Assets (VDAs) under Indian tax laws, do not flow through this channel, risking violations of and mandatory reporting. NGOs accepting crypto face volatility risks of 15-20% price swings, forcing speculative timing that burdens budgeting and violates FCRA bans on mutual funds or speculative investments. Additional challenges include custody controls, real-time valuations, reconciliations for source disclosure, and non-cash inflow documentation to protect FCRA registration.

FCRA Bank Account Opening Process

1) Get the Account Opening Form (AOF) -

Download the AOF from the SBI website or collect it from any convenient SBI branch.

Fill the form and attach all mandatory KYC documents for signatories and controllers/beneficial owners as per RBI guidelines.

Submit at Any SBI Branch

Submit the completed application and documents at any SBI branch (not mandatory to visit NDMB, New Delhi).

Receive an acknowledgement from the branch.

Verification and Forwarding

The receiving SBI branch scrutinizes and verifies the documents, then emails the scanned documents to SBI NDMB within 3 working days.

2) Processing at the SBI NDMB -

SBI NDMB acknowledges receipt by email within 1 working day.

Within the next 3 working days, NDMB processes the application and opens the designated FCRA account. Details are sent by SMS and email to the registered contacts.

3) Activation (Post MHA FCRA Approval)

NDMB activates the account for foreign remittance after confirmation of FCRA registration or prior permission by the Ministry of Home Affairs.

4) Checklist - Required Documents

Filled Account Opening Form.

KYC of signatories and beneficial owners (as per RBI norms).

Board Resolution copy.

PAN or Form 60, recent photograph of signatories, proof of address.

The Maharashtra Chief Minister’s Relief Fund (CMRF) has secured approval from the MHA to accept contributions from foreign donors under the Foreign Contribution Regulation Act (FCRA), making it the first state in India to receive such authorization. This decision marks a significant policy shift, enabling the CMRF to tap into international funding, including from multinational corporations, NRIs, and Indian companies abroad, to bolster its relief and welfare initiatives.

The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A) has introduced significant changes to the Foreign Contribution (Regulation) Rules, 2011 through a notification dated 31st December 2024, effective from 1st January 2025.

Here are the highlights of the amendments:

1. 👁️‍🗨️ 𝐂𝐚𝐫𝐫𝐲 𝐅𝐨𝐫𝐰𝐚𝐫𝐝 𝐨𝐟 𝐔𝐧𝐬𝐩𝐞𝐧𝐭 𝐀𝐝𝐦𝐢𝐧𝐢𝐬𝐭𝐫𝐚𝐭𝐢𝐯𝐞 𝐄𝐱𝐩𝐞𝐧𝐬𝐞𝐬: Associations can now carry forward the unspent portion of allowable administrative expenses to the next financial year, provided reasons are specified in Form FC-4.

2. 👁️‍🗨️ 𝐔𝐩𝐝𝐚𝐭𝐞𝐬 𝐢𝐧 𝐅𝐨𝐫𝐦 𝐅𝐂-4: New Provisions inserted -

(a) Reporting transfer of foreign contribution as part of an income tax refund from a non-FCRA bank account.

(b) Detailed reporting for the carry forward of unspent administrative expenses.

(c) Requirement to provide the Chartered Accountant's details, who is issuing certificates under sub-rule (5) of rule 17.

3. 👁️‍🗨️ 𝐍𝐞𝐰 𝐂𝐞𝐫𝐭𝐢𝐟𝐢𝐜𝐚𝐭𝐢𝐨𝐧 𝐑𝐞𝐪𝐮𝐢𝐫𝐞𝐦𝐞𝐧𝐭 𝐟𝐨𝐫 𝐂𝐡𝐚𝐫𝐭𝐞𝐫𝐞𝐝 𝐀𝐜𝐜𝐨𝐮𝐧𝐭𝐚𝐧𝐭𝐬: CAs must explicitly certify whether there were any violations of the FCRA Act, with details if applicable.

👁️‍🗨️ *Section (4) (f) of the FCRA, 2010*

The acceptance of foreign contribution by the person referred to in sub-section (1) is not likely to affect prejudicially —

📌 (i) the sovereignty and integrity of India;

📌 (ii) the security, strategic, scientific or economic interest of the State;

📌 (iii) the public interest;

📌 (iv) freedom or fairness of election to any Legislature;

📌 (v) friendly relation with any foreign State;

📌 (vi) harmony between religious, racial, social, linguistic, regional groups, castes or communities.

*How to file 'Revision Application' under Section 32 of FCRA, 2010?*

Any NGO that like to file an application for revision of an order passed by the competent authority (MHA, FCRA) may upload a scanned copy of its application on the FCRAonline portal under ‘Services under FCRA’, sub heading ‘Revision Application under Section 32, FCRA 2010.’

1. 💁🏻‍♀️ A scanned copy of the duly signed application on plain paper is acceptable. MHA has neither provided any specific FCRA Form nor suggested a format for application. The application must provide justification for Revision of the Order and must be submitted with supporting documents, if any.

2. 💁🏻‍♀️ Fee — A fee of Rs. 3,000/- It can be paid through the payment gateway.

3. 💁🏻‍♀️ Time frame — The application must be made within one year from the date of order against which revision is sought or the date on which the organization otherwise came to know of it, whichever is earlier.

The Karnataka High Court annulled the MHA's order to cancel the registration of Centre for Wildlife Studies (CWS) under the Foreign Contribution Regulation Act (FCRA), 2010.

*The FCRA (2010) under subsection 14(2) allows for the cancellation of registration, and subsection 14(3) prevents the NGO from re-registering under FCRA for three years.*

The Karnataka High Court said in order passed on 25 June 2024 -

"The words depicted in the Act ‘reasonable opportunity of being heard’ cannot be restricted to issuance of a show cause notice but a personal hearing in the peculiar facts of the case owing to the peculiarity of sub-section (3) of Section 14 of the Act must have been afforded to the petitioner."
